Versatile access to Martin's spirosilanes and their hypervalent derivatives

J Org Chem. 2015 Mar 20;80(6):3280-8. doi: 10.1021/jo5028497. Epub 2015 Mar 4.

Abstract

A new route to Martin's spirosilanes has been devised. The original synthesis does not allow diversely substituted spirosilane derivatives to be synthesized, and thus their corresponding silicates. In this report, Martin's spirosilanes bearing alkyl, aryl, halogen, alkoxy, and trifluoromethyl substituents on the aryl ring have been prepared through a versatile four-step route. Addition of fluoride onto these Lewis acids as a prototypical reaction with a nucleophile yielded a library of stable fluorosilicates. Both sets of compounds have been characterized by X-ray crystallography.
